Turdus migratorius
American Robins are fairly large songbirds with a large, round body, long legs, and fairly long tail. American Robins are gray-brown birds with warm orange underparts and dark heads. In flight, a white patch on the lower belly and under the tail can be conspicuous. Compared with males, females have paler heads that contrast less with the gray.
